Shareable commitlint config enforcing the angular commit convention
@commitlint/config-angular is a shareable configuration for commitlint that follows the Angular commit message guidelines. It helps enforce a consistent commit message format in your project, which is particularly useful for projects that follow the Angular style guide.
Enforcing Commit Message Format
This configuration enforces the Angular commit message format. By extending `@commitlint/config-angular`, your project will adhere to the Angular commit message conventions, ensuring consistency and readability.
{
"extends": ["@commitlint/config-angular"]
}
Customizing Rules
You can customize the commit message rules by extending the default configuration. In this example, the `type-enum` rule is customized to include specific types of commit messages such as `feat`, `fix`, `docs`, etc.

@commitlint/config-conventional is another shareable configuration for commitlint that follows the conventional commit message guidelines. It is similar to @commitlint/config-angular but adheres to the broader conventional commits specification rather than the Angular-specific guidelines.
Commitizen is a tool that helps you write consistent commit messages by providing an interactive prompt. While @commitlint/config-angular enforces commit message rules, Commitizen assists in the creation of those messages, ensuring they follow a specified format.
cz-conventional-changelog is an adapter for Commitizen that helps you write commit messages following the conventional changelog format. It is similar to @commitlint/config-angular in that it enforces a specific commit message format, but it does so through an interactive prompt rather than linting.
Lint your commits, angular-style
Shareable commitlint
config enforcing the Angular commit convention.
Use with @commitlint/cli and @commitlint/prompt-cli.
npm install --save-dev @commitlint/config-angular @commitlint/cli
echo "export default {extends: ['@commitlint/config-angular']};" > commitlint.config.js
The following rules are considered problems for @commitlint/config-angular
and will yield a non-zero exit code when not met.
Consult Rules reference for a list of available rules.

The angular commit
convention
does not use a !
to define a breaking change in the commit subject. If you
want to use this feature please consider using the conventional commit
config.
